the significance of Purity in Chemical Raw Materials for Electroless Nickel Plating

Purity is paramount On the subject of chemical Uncooked materials Employed in the electroless nickel plating process. Impurities may lead to inconsistent plating results, lessening the overall good quality in the coated floor. significant-purity substances make sure that the plating approach operates smoothly, providing a uniform coating that satisfies industrial criteria. from the electroless nickel system, even trace quantities of contaminants could potentially cause defects for example pits, blisters, or poor adhesion, which compromise the functionality and aesthetics of the ultimate product or service. Ensuring that the Uncooked products meet stringent purity technical specs is important for achieving the desired outcomes continuously.

How higher-high quality Uncooked Materials bring on Superior Electroless Nickel Coatings

significant-top quality Uncooked products will be the bedrock of exceptional electroless nickel coatings. For illustration, Fengfan's Environmentally Medium Phosphorus Electroless Nickel procedure, FF-607, features a phosphorus material of 7 to 9%, along with a hardness ranging from 550 to 600 HV. following warmth procedure, the hardness can get to up to 1000 HV. these types of exact specifications are attainable only when significant-good quality raw supplies are used. The excellent bonding power on medium and small carbon steel, which may get to around 450 MPa, more exemplifies the importance of quality Uncooked elements. if the Uncooked products are of high quality top quality, the resultant nickel layer exhibits great soldering general performance, uniformity, and a vibrant, steady gloss all through its services life.

The part of Chemical Consistency in acquiring Optimal Plating final results

regularity in chemical Uncooked elements performs a pivotal function in achieving optimal ends in electroless nickel plating. variants in chemical composition may result in fluctuations while in the plating method, causing uneven coatings and subpar excellent. applying raw resources with consistent chemical Houses makes certain that the plating bathtub remains stable, manufacturing a uniform nickel layer with predictable Qualities. Fengfan's FF-607 approach, by way of example, offers a stable plating Option using a extensive company life of as much as 8 MTO (Metal Turnover), guaranteeing constant effectiveness in excess of extended durations. The steady high quality of raw resources can help manage the desired plating pace of one micron per three minutes, achieving a uniform, white, and vivid layer with no want for additional processing.
